A CENTURIES-OLD farmhouse is set to be converted into a state-of-the-art studio and become the new home for a popular Swindon business. 

GEL Studios, an award-winning creative agency, started working on its new premises based in South Marston at the beginning of February and is almost ready to move in.

The firm has launched a number of new services over the past two years which has meant the team has grown exponentially. As a result, a bigger and better studio was the next step ahead of its 10-year anniversary in June.

The new studio which is located just a few doors down from the agency's current base within South Marston Industrial Estate will be in a converted farmhouse.

Having nearly completed its B-corp certification, GEL Studios has planned the development to make it as sustainable as possible, using local tradespeople, environmentally friendly materials and installing efficient energy systems.

It has worked with local workplace interior designer, Debbie Watts, from Ashlar-ID to repurpose the historic building and turn it into a creative hub for the team, its clients and the community.

Managing director Graeme Leighfield said: “Swindon has been GEL Studios' home for 10 years this summer. We can’t wait to open our state-of-the-art studios and continue inspiring change through creativity. 

"As our studio, team and clients grow, our commitment to do good for our local community grows too. While many businesses look to downsize or close their offices completely, we’re committed to playing an active part in Swindon’s community for years to come.”
